Related Cross References
Psalm 147:4
Both verses highlight God's sovereignty over the stars and constellations.
Isaiah 40:26
This verse also emphasizes God's power in creation, particularly in relation to the stars.
Genesis 1:14
Genesis describes the creation of celestial bodies, linking to God's authority over them.
